† [
חָבַר] 
verb unite (usually intransitive), 
be joined, tie a magic knot or 
spell, charm (Late Hebrew 
id.; Ethiopic 
ኀበሪ፡ yet Assyrian [
abâru], 
ubburu bind, ban (of spells), 
êbru, 
friend, and many derivatives, Dl
W 51 ff.; Aramaic 
rfbfo חַבֵּר and many derivatives; compare Phoenician noun 
חבר associate) — 
Qal Perfect 3rd person masculine plural חָֽבְרוּ Genesis 14:3 Participle active masculine 
חֹבֵר Deuteronomy 18:11,
חוֺבֵר Psalm 58:6; feminine plural
חֹבְרֹת Exodus 26:3 (twice in verse) + 
2 times + 
Ezekiel 1:9 (compare below), 
חוֺבְרוֺת Ezekiel 1:11; 
Passive participle construct 
חֲבוּר Hosea 4:17 (yet. see below); — 
    1. unite, be joined:
    a. of allies, followed by 
אֶלֹֿ location 
Genesis 14:3, construction pregnant = 
came as allies unto; passive participle figurative 
חֲבוּר עֲצַבִּים אֶפְרָ֖יִם Hosea 4:17 Ephraim is joined to idols (but We reads 
חבר, see 
חבֵר 2d, and compare 
חֲבֵרָיו Isaiah 44:11, 
חֲבֶרְתְּךָ Malachi 2:14).
 
    b. of one thing reaching to, touching another; wings of Ezekiel's living creatures followed by 
אֶלֿ of thing, 
Ezekiel 1:9 (strike out 

 B Co, but see Sm); compare 
אישׁ ח׳, 
Ezekiel 1:11, i.e. 
joining each one (transitive), < 
 
 
 Co 
אשׁה ח׳ אלאֿחותה (as 
Ezekiel 1:9), 
united each to the other; so of curtains of tabernacle, followed by 
אֶלֿ of thing 
Exodus 26:3 (twice in verse); absolute 
joined together, of shoulderpieces of ephod 
Exodus 28:7 (all P; compare also 
Pu.).
 
    2. tie magic knots, charm (RS
JPh xiv. 1885, 123 thinks meaning 
charm is derived from 
nectere verba, and compare Arabic 
خَبَر, 
narrative); only with accusative of congnate meaning with verb 
חָ֑בֶר ה׳ Deuteronomy 18:11 (in a long series of kindred phrases), specifically of charming serpents 
Psalm 58:6 (|| 
מְלַחֲשִׁים).
 
Pi. Perfect 3rd person masculine singular חִבַּר Exodus 36:10; 
2nd person masculine singular וְחִבַּרְתָּ֫ Exodus 26:6 + 
2 times; 
Imperfect וַיְחַבֵּר Exodus 36:10 + 
2 times; suffix 
וַיְחַבְּרֵהוּ 2 Chronicles 20:36; 
Infinitive construct לְחַבֵּר Exodus 36:18; — 
    1. make an ally of unite one with, only 
ויחברהו עִמּוֺ 2 Chronicles 20:36 and he united him with himself, followed by Infinitive purpose.
 
Pu. Perfect 3rd person masculine singular חֻבָּ֑ר Exodus 39:4, 
וְחֻבָּ֑ר consec 
Exodus 28:7 (but see below) 
3rd person feminine singular שֶׁחֻבְּרָהֿ Psalm 122:3; 
Imperfect 3rd person masculine singular יְחֻבַּר Ecclesiastes 9:4 Qr (Kt 
יבחר see below); suffix 
הַיְחָבְרְךָ Psalm 94:20 (Kö
i. 257 f.; Ges Ew Bö De and others as 
Qal; — 
    1. a. be allied with thee (suffix reference to 
י׳) 
Psalm 94:20;
 
    b. be united to = be one of, אל כלֿ מי אשׁר יְח׳ הַחַיִּם whoever is united to all the living (Kt יבחר is meaningless).
    2. be joined together, of ephod 
עַלשְֿׁנֵי קְצוֺותָ֯ו ח׳ Exodus 39:4 by its two edges was it joined together; compare || 
Exodus 28:7 (where MT 
אֶלשְֿׁנֵי קְצוֺתיו וְחֻבָּ֑ר < 

 Samaritan which read 
ק׳ עַלשֿׁ׳ יְחֻבָּ֑ר); 
לָֿהּ עִיר שֶׁח׳ Psalm 122:3 joined together for itself i.e. compactly built (of Jerusalem).
 
Hiph. Imperfect 1st person singular אַחְבִּ֫ירָה עליכם בְּמִלִּים Job 16:4 I could make a joining with words (i.e. 
join words together RV VB) 
against you. 
Hithp. (late) 
Perfect אֶתְחַבֵּר (Ges
§ 541 n.) 
2 Chronicles 20:35; 
Imperfect יִתְחַבָּ֑רוּ Daniel 11:6; 
Infinitive suffix 
הִתְחַבֶּרְךָ 2 Chronicles 20:37; Aramaic form 
הִתְחַבְּרוּת Daniel 11:23 (Ges
§ 54, 3 R. 1) — 
join oneself to, make an alliance with, followed by
עִם person 
2 Chronicles 20:35, 
37, followed by 
אֶלֿ person 
Daniel 11:23; reciprocal 
league together (absolute) 
Daniel 11:6.
